I make up a 4 mm flat steel strap to fit on the steering box bolt closest
to the inner guard. Plate the wheel well side of the inner guard with a
piece of approximately 75mm x 75mm x 2 mm sheet as reinforcing with the
plate centred as close as possible to the where the strap will make contact
at the closest point. Mark up and drill a hole through the reinforcing and
then fit the steel strap. It makes a big difference!
